THERMAL INSULATION (Hot & Cold)

Rockwool Mattress is used for both hot and cold insulation to conserve energy, maintain process temperature, provide personnel protection, prevent condensation and reduce noise level. Rockwool mattresses are used for thermal insulation of pipes, tanks, equipments, boilers, electrostatic precipitators. Flues and ventilation ducts, ovens, furnaces, kilns and fire insulation of fire doors.

It is a precisely engineered bonded fibrous insulation that offers maximum resistance to the passage of heat. Rock wool Fibers are  spun from selected rocks, melted at 1600°C and blended to a  carefully adjusted chemical composition. Its centrifugally spun fibers have a diameter 1/20th that of human hair. These are felted using state-of-the-art technology into bonded and cured slabs to optimum density and resilience.

Rock wool Mattress has excellent stability and has no chicken feathering which pollutes the atmosphere during application. It has controlled thickness and density resulting in predictable heat losses. 

Rock wool Pipe Insulation

Rock wool Pipe Insulation products are available for hot face temperatures up to 750’C. Rock wool Pipe Insulation is supplied as one-piece sections of one meter length, up to 4” and in two sections for 4” N.B. and above slit along the longitudinal axis. Sections are easily installed by opening the slit and springing the section into position over the pipe.

ACOUSTIC INSULATION Glass

Glass wool is a synthetic mineral fiber that is made of long glass wool bounded with thermosetting resin has found its way into domestic, commercial and industrial buildings as a thermal and acoustic insulation product.

Characteristic Glass wool offers the best mix of advantages for insulation:-

1.Thermal Resistance
2. Acoustical Absorption
3.Fire resistance
4. Lightness
5.Environmentally friendly
6. Easy Installation

      PANELLING

Panelling is a wall covering constructed from rigid or semi-rigid components. These are traditionally interlocking wood, but could be plastic or other materials.

Panelling was to make rooms more comfortable. The panels served to insulate the room from the cold as well as help in acoustics. In more modern buildings, such panelling is often installed for decorative purposes.

DECK COVERING

Increasingly sophisticated technology has meant that shipping and shipbuilding industries are receiving more and more exacting demands from ship-owners and passengers.Today, ship flooring has to carry out a wide range of different functions-from sound and fire protection to safety and design features.

Repair and renovation of Deck Flooring jobs entail: Area,Breaking and removal of old composition and clearing the area, Grinding and wire-brushing the bare plates.

Primer Coating of the plate before application of Deck Covering (Curing time approx.. 4-5 hours) Application of Deck Composition, depending upon the requirement and thickness which could range from normal cement composition to specialized Flooring.

There could be a composition coat which could be 3mm, 6mm to 12mm as required. Depending on the flooring requirement in accommodation areas, there could be an underlay before the ‘Top Coat’ which could be 12mm to 50 or even 75mm in thickness.

FRP (Fibre-Reinforced Plastic)

Fibre-reinforced plastic is a composite material made of a   polymer matrix reinforced with fibers. The fibres are usually glass,carbon, basalt or aramid, although other fibres such as paper or wood or asbestos have been sometimes used. They are best suited for any design program that demands Weight savings, precision engineering, finite tolerances, and the simplification of parts in both production and  operation. 

FRP can be applied to strengthen the beams, columns, and slabs  of buildings and bridges. It is possible to increase the strength of structural members even after they have been severely damaged due to loading conditions. In the case of damaged reinforced concrete members, this would first require the repair of the member by removing loose debris and filling in cavities and cracks with mortar or epoxy resin. Once the member is repaired, strengthening can be achieved through wet, hand lay-up of impregnating the fibre sheets with epoxy resin then applying them to the cleaned, prepared surface of the member.

FLOATING FLOOR INSULATION (Rockwool)

The Floating Floor Insulation is designed for universal applications on ships and offshore installations. It consists of a specially developed Rockwool insulation material surfaced by steel plate. This special insulation adds significantly to the strength of the surface. It has high load bearing capacity with steel surface and allows easy and fast installation. The floating floor serves the purpose of absorbing vibrations and sound that spread through the steel deck.
